A chimney cap prevents rain, debris, and animals from entering your flue. If your cap is loose, rusted, or missing, it leaves your chimney vulnerable to expensive water damage. Yes, a leaning chimney in Fishers can become an issue over time due to foundation settling or structural stress. This problem requires professional attention to ensure the chimney's stability and safety. The pros will assess the cause of the lean and recommend the best repair method, which might involve structural reinforcement or rebuilding. If your chimney in Fishers has a leak, you might notice water stains on the ceiling or walls around the chimney. You could also see dampness on the exterior brickwork or around the flashing where the chimney meets the roof. Sometimes, efflorescence, a white powdery substance, appears on the bricks, indicating moisture intrusion. Addressing leaks promptly prevents internal structural damage.
